SALT LAKE CITY — The third phase of Salt Lake County's Parley's Trail will soon open.
When fully complete, Parley's Trail will be about 8 miles long and will be the major east-west connector trail through Millcreek Township, Salt Lake City and South Salt Lake City. The trail currently spans from Tanner Park eastward over Interstate 215 via a pedestrian bridge and connects with the Bonneville Shoreline Trail.
Salt Lake County Mayor Peter Corroon will open another portion of the trail on Friday. The third phase is nearly a mile long and runs from the pedestrian bridge to Tanner Park.
When the new section of trail opens, volunteers will begin planting trees and shrubs along its path to help restore vegetation.
